logging.entries.write

POST {{baseUrl}}/v2/entries:write?$.xgafv=<string>&access_token=<string>&alt=<string>&callback=<string>&fields=<string>&key=<string>&oauth_token=<string>&prettyPrint=<boolean>&quotaUser=<string>&upload_protocol=<string>&uploadType=<string>

Writes log entries to Logging. This API method is the only way to send log entries to Logging. This method is used, directly or indirectly, by the Logging agent (fluentd) and all logging libraries configured to use Logging. A single request may contain log entries for a maximum of 1000 different resources (projects, organizations, billing accounts or folders)

Request Params

KeyDatatypeRequiredDescription
$.xgafvstringV1 error format.
access_tokenstringOAuth access token.
altstringData format for response.
callbackstringJSONP
fieldsstringSelector specifying which fields to include in a partial response.
keystringAPI key. Your API key identifies your project and provides you with API access, quota, and reports. Required unless you provide an OAuth 2.0 token.
oauth_tokenstringOAuth 2.0 token for the current user.
prettyPrintstringReturns response with indentations and line breaks.
quotaUserstringAvailable to use for quota purposes for server-side applications. Can be any arbitrary string assigned to a user, but should not exceed 40 characters.
upload_protocolstringUpload protocol for media (e.g. "raw", "multipart").
uploadTypestringLegacy upload protocol for media (e.g. "media", "multipart").

Request Body

{"dryRun"=>"<boolean>", "entries"=>[{"httpRequest"=>{"cacheFillBytes"=>"elit incididunt in", "cacheHit"=>false, "cacheLookup"=>true, "cacheValidatedWithOriginServer"=>false, "latency"=>"aliquip culpa sunt cons", "protocol"=>"aliqua cillum veniam tempor", "referer"=>"laboris id in tempor", "remoteIp"=>"sed cupidatat in veniam", "requestMethod"=>"Duis ut ullamco Excepteur", "requestSize"=>"el", "requestUrl"=>"et nulla ex occaecat dolor", "responseSize"=>"ea laborum a", "serverIp"=>"id inc", "status"=>90234556, "userAgent"=>"amet esse"}, "insertId"=>"in Excepteur dolore", "logName"=>"esse", "operation"=>{"first"=>true, "id"=>"aliquip Duis ex", "last"=>false, "producer"=>"enim Lorem amet sunt"}, "receiveTimestamp"=>"aliqua dolor", "resource"=>{"type"=>"qui in"}, "severity"=>"DEFAULT", "sourceLocation"=>{"file"=>"et consectetur minim", "function"=>"nostrud laboris fugiat sunt non", "line"=>"ex dolor amet"}, "spanId"=>"magna dolore sint", "textPayload"=>"laborum nisi cillum ea", "timestamp"=>"fugiat elit", "trace"=>"incididunt officia cupidatat ad", "traceSampled"=>false}, {"httpRequest"=>{"cacheFillBytes"=>"in ipsum et", "cacheHit"=>false, "cacheLookup"=>true, "cacheValidatedWithOriginServer"=>true, "latency"=>"laborum nostrud culpa sed", "protocol"=>"laboris tempor dolore", "referer"=>"esse", "remoteIp"=>"dolore E", "requestMethod"=>"aliquip anim commodo consectetur Ut", "requestSize"=>"nulla Ut Excepteur commodo", "requestUrl"=>"aute culpa", "responseSize"=>"occaecat id adipisicing aute laborum", "serverIp"=>"eu fugiat", "status"=>91916531, "userAgent"=>"qui dolore"}, "insertId"=>"laboris Excepteur minim commodo", "logName"=>"culpa reprehenderit", "operation"=>{"first"=>true, "id"=>"non velit proident", "last"=>false, "producer"=>"reprehenderit"}, "receiveTimestamp"=>"Duis in", "resource"=>{"type"=>"do dolore ut"}, "severity"=>"DEFAULT", "sourceLocation"=>{"file"=>"qui commodo non", "function"=>"elit in in", "line"=>"quis incididunt sed aliquip"}, "spanId"=>"ve", "textPayload"=>"labore veniam Duis", "timestamp"=>"Excepteur irure", "trace"=>"laborum Duis do", "traceSampled"=>false}], "labels"=>"<object>", "logName"=>"<string>", "partialSuccess"=>"<boolean>", "resource"=>{"type"=>"Lorem in"}}

HEADERS

KeyDatatypeRequiredDescription
Content-Typestring

RESPONSES

status: OK

{}